Output 6038d1885c691b3530d27d85c96e4f2643a59149ef505778afe176436caa1aec:15

value
2150854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6778d6dcd5cdcf03b47019e153b9874e56c637e1 OP_EQUAL
address
3B88HN6aHdCpU2YEx1KiY5HSVGknuMiw2C
transaction
6038d1885c691b3530d27d85c96e4f2643a59149ef505778afe176436caa1aec
spent
true